LEINSTER SQUARE, W2

Positioned on the lower ground floor of an elegant stucco-fronted, Grade II listed terrace on Leinster Square, this beautifully presented two-bedroom apartment offers generous proportions, refined period detailing and direct access to the communal garden square.

Extending to almost 980 sq ft (plus 98 sq ft of storage in the vaults), the apartment pairs contemporary finishes with real period character — sash windows, elegant proportions and bespoke joinery throughout, with two private patios bringing in exceptional light for a lower ground-floor home.

INSIDE

The living/dining room anchors the apartment — a bright, generously proportioned space measuring over 18ft in both directions, with a large sash window overlooking the private patio to the front. The impressive ceiling height is a particular highlight.

The principal bedroom is a well-proportioned double with an ensuite bathroom and built-in wardrobes. The second double bedroom has its own access onto a private patio and is served by a separate shower room.

The kitchen sits to the front, fitted with a considered range of cabinetry and ample worktop space, overlooking the front patio. Two additional storage vaults add practicality rarely found at this size.

OUTSIDE

The apartment benefits from two private patios — one located at the entrance to the property, with the other accessed from the second bedroom. Beyond this, residents also share access to the substantial communal garden to the rear, extending to approximately 47ft x 19ft — a rare offering for a lower ground-floor apartment and a real point of difference in this part of Bayswater.

The apartment also benefits from access to Leinster Square’s verdant communal gardens, filled with mature trees, flowerbeds and winding pathways.

NEIGHBOURHOOD

Leinster Square sits on the quiet, leafy cusp of Bayswater and Notting Hill — moments from Portobello Road and the buzz of Westbourne Grove. For coffee and brunch, Daylesford Organic and Farm Girl Café are firm local favourites; for dinner, Granger & Co., Zephyr and Acre are among the neighbourhood’s most talked-about tables. Ottolenghi’s deli sits just around the corner for weekend essentials.

The landmark Whiteley development is also close by, bringing together an Everyman Cinema, Third Space gym and the exceptional Six Senses spa, alongside a collection of shops and places to eat.

Bayswater and Queensway stations provide access to the District, Circle and Central lines, while Notting Hill Gate is also within easy reach for further connections. Hyde Park and Kensington Gardens are just three blocks away, perfectly placed for a morning run or a leisurely Sunday stroll.
